This is probably a record: oldest man to put on tefillin for the first time
Quote: | A pair of enthusiastic Temimim finally persuaded an elderly man to don Tefillin for the first time in his life at age 101.
This week on Friday Mivtzoim, tmimim Levi Kaye and Chaim Rosenstien finally convinced Mr Pinchus (Paul) Greenberg to put on tefilin for the first time! Pinchus is 101 years old and is currently living at the "Care One" Old Age Home in Morristown, N.J. He had told the bochurim he never had put on tefilin before, which after some research was confirmed by last year's Mivtzoim Chavrusa Bochurim who used to visit him when he was 99.
They told Levi Kaye that they had tried but were unable to convince him to perform this mitzva till now. Boruch Hashem on the Bochurims' second visit to him this past Friday Parshas "Ki Tatzai" they finally succeeded in convincing him to put on tefilin.
The Bochurim later explained to Pinchus that it's never too late to do a mitzva! |
